The survival horror landscape is often dominated by giants like Resident Evil and Silent Hill , but deep within the history of mobile gaming lies a cult classic that many players hold dear: . Originally developed for Symbian and J2ME platforms, this 3D horror title was a marvel of its time, pushing the limits of mid-2000s hardware. Recently, interest has surged around the 7 Days Salvation Remake , a project dedicated to modernizing this atmospheric experience for contemporary audiences on PC and modern consoles. Released in the era of Nokia smartphones and the Dingoo A320, the original 7 Days (developed by Dingoo Games) was renowned for its high-quality 3D graphics and mature, dark plot. Players took on the role of Ken, a horror novel writer living in a mysterious castle who must survive seven days of bizarre, supernatural events.
